5 Reasons Why Light Painting Is the Photo Booth of the Future
For years, photo booths have been the go-to entertainment option at weddings, birthday parties, and corporate gatherings. But today’s guests want more than props and printouts—they crave immersive experiences they can share and remember.
That’s where light painting comes in. This innovative technique uses long-exposure photography and handheld light sources to “paint” glowing visuals around guests, resulting in breathtaking, one-of-a-kind images.
